What is an E-way Invoice Database?
An E-way Invoice Database is a digital repository where all your e-way invoices are stored, organized, and easily accessed. In India, under the GST regime, businesses are required to generate an e-way invoice for the transportation of goods valued above a specified threshold. The E-way Invoice Databases ensures that all these invoices are stored securely, making it easier to track, audit, and access them whenever needed.

How Does an E-way Invoice Database Work?
At its core, an E-way Invoice Databases works by automating the creation, storage, and management of e-way invoices. When goods are moved, businesses can generate an e-way invoice digitally, which is then stored in the database.
Typically, the database will contain the following types of information:
Invoice Number: A unique identifier for each e-way invoice.
Date of Issue: The date when the invoice was generated.
Sender and Receiver Details: Information about the business sending and receiving the goods.
Product Details: Information about the goods being transported, including their description, quantity, and value.
Transporter Information: Details of the transporter responsible for moving the goods.
This data is organized and can be filtered or searched based on various parameters like invoice number, date, product type, and more.

How to Set Up an E-way Invoice Databases
Setting up an E-way Invoice Database doesn’t have to be complicated. Here are a few steps to get started:
1. Choose a Suitable Platform
You can either opt for cloud-based platforms or software solutions that specialize in e-way invoices. Cloud solutions are particularly useful for small and medium-sized businesses as they offer scalability and remote access.
2. Input Your Data
Start by entering your business information, GST details, and other essential data. Once this is done, you can begin generating and storing e-way invoices directly in the database.
3. Integrate with GST Systems
Most modern E-way Invoice Database solutions allow integration with the GSTN (Goods and Services Tax Network), which enables direct upload and filing of e-way invoices. This integration can simplify the filing process and reduce errors.
4. Monitor and Update Regularly
It’s important to keep your database up-to-date. Ensure that any changes to your inventory, pricing, or GST status are reflected in the database.
